YANG launches monthly virtual networking series for industry professionals

Parts Authority’s Randy Buller will lead the first hour-long session on Feb. 24 to discuss the topic of mergers and acquisitions in the aftermarket

Bethesda, Md.—The Young Auto Care Network Group (YANG), an under-40 community of the Auto Care Association, has announced a new virtual networking series for YANG members and mentors. The YANG Professional Series is a new monthly virtual event that brings together YANG members to discuss key issues, hot topics and opportunities in the automotive aftermarket.

“The YANG council wants to continue to engage our community members through professional development and educational opportunities,” said Cotter Collins, SMP and YANG council vice-chair. “There’s no better way to do that than by combining our own curiosity about current events with some expert industry voices.”

Each hour-long session will feature an industry leader sharing their perspective on an important issue of the day, followed by virtual networking among attendees.

The inaugural YANG Professional Series event will take place on Thursday, Feb. 24, from 2 p.m. – 3 p.m. ET and will feature Randy Buller, president and CEO, Parts Authority. Buller will discuss the topic of mergers and acquisitions in the automotive aftermarket. Parts Authority is a “Heavy Duty” level YANG sponsor.
